Cross of Agadez

This cross is normally referred to as the Muslim cross. There is no bearing of it on Islam or Christianity and is actually a geometric cross pattern that is used mostly by the Sunni Muslim Tuareg people of Sharan Africa (Drum, 2022). The middle of the cross represents God. The area on the cross stands for protection to keep evil at bay. This symbol is usually used as a protective amulet; it is also considered the symbol of faith and a way to keep away negative energy.
